The Al-Vista Model 5F was manufactured by the Multiscope & Film Co. of Burlington Wisconsin from approximately 1901 to 1908. This camera was able to be configured for snap shots on glass plates or panoramic views on roll-film cartridges. The front assemble was interchangeable for either a traditional bellows and lens or it could be fitted with the Al-Vista revolving panoramic lens front assembly. The camera featured an attachment for taking negatives of different lengths with the same camera including, 5 x 4, 5 x 6, 5 x 8, 5 x 10, and 5 x 12 inches. Originally priced in 1908 at $45.00 for the camera using 5-inch film and 4 x5 plates with an extra rapid rectilinear lens and shutter and $80.00 for a camera fitted with Burlington Anastigmat lens f6.8, with plate attachment, rectilinear lens and shutter. --- The rare convertible model with panoramic front in perfect original condition.
